Mariana: Tencent Deep Learning Platform and its Applications

Summary: Mariana is Tencent’s production deep-learning platform, combining multi-GPU data/model parallelism with CPU-cluster training for billion-sample, multi-million-parameter models. Built-in algorithms and experiment support accelerate model selection, powering ASR, image recognition, and pCTR applications. (summarized by gpt-5.6-luna on Jul 24 2026)
